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Allen's Olingo | Hairy Big-eared Bat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(동물) | Animalia (동물)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(척삭동물) | Chordata (척삭동물) |
| Class same | Mammalia (포유류) | Mammalia (포유류) |
| Order | Carnivora (식육목) | Chiroptera (박쥐) |
| Family | Procyonidae (Raccoons) | Phyllostomidae |
| Genus | Bassaricyon | Micronycteris |
| Species | Bassaricyon alleni | Micronycteris hirsuta |
Evolutionary Relationship
Allen's Olingo and Hairy Big-eared Bat share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(포유류)
